'Jungnang Haengbok Geulpan' Autumn Edition Applications Open from August 3
From August 3 to August 20, 'Jungnang Happiness Bulletin Board' Fall Edition Text Contest... Accepting Original Autumn-Themed Phrases Within 30 Characters
[Asia Economy Reporter Park Jong-il] Jungnang-gu (Mayor Ryu Kyung-gi) will accept submissions for the autumn edition of the ‘Jungnang Happiness Bulletin Board,’ which conveys happiness and hope to residents by capturing the emotions of the upcoming fall, from August 3 to August 20.
Anyone residing or working in the Jungnang-gu area can submit one entry per person. The submission should be an original phrase within 30 characters that evokes the feeling of autumn, with a theme that offers warm comfort to residents of all generations who visit the district office.
Completed original phrases can be submitted through the Jungnang-gu Office website (Citizen Participation → Internet Submission). If online submission is difficult, entries can be delivered in person to the Administrative Support Division of Jungnang-gu Office or sent by mail (4th floor, Administrative Support Division, 179 Bonghwasan-ro, Jungnang-gu).
A phrase selection committee composed of internal and external members will review the submissions and select a total of six works. Prizes include 500,000 KRW in Jungnang Love Gift Certificates for the winning entry and 100,000 KRW each for five runners-up, totaling approximately 1,000,000 KRW.
The winning phrase, accompanied by a beautiful design matching the text, will be displayed on the exterior wall of the Jungnang-gu Office building from September to November.
Mayor Ryu Kyung-gi of Jungnang-gu said, “I hope residents feel the small joys of daily life through the Jungnang Happiness Bulletin Board, which meets residents in different colors each season,” and added, “We ask for many residents’ participation so that the clear and abundant autumn can be felt.”
